Answer:
induced emf  = rate of change of flux
 
let e be induced emf and φ be the flux, then we have    e = -(dφ)/dt 
 
when induced emf is generated in the loop, there is a current in the loop, hence we write,  e = | (dφ)/dt | = i×R .............(1)
 
where i is the current and R is the resistance of loop.
 
If A is the area of loop and B is magnetic field induction, then magneti flux φ = A×B.
 
Hence eqn.(1) is rewritten as,  begin mathsize 12px style fraction numerator d phi over denominator d t end fraction space equals space fraction numerator d left parenthesis A cross times B right parenthesis over denominator d t end fraction space equals space i cross times R end style .................(2)
since area A is constant, we rewrite eqn.(2) as begin mathsize 12px style fraction numerator A cross times d B over denominator R end fraction space equals space i cross times d t space equals space q space.............. left parenthesis 3 right parenthesis end style
In eqn.(3), q is the charge flowing in the loop. dB is change of field,
when Field B is switched off to zero in a time dt, we can take dB = (B-0) = B.
 
Wire of resistance R is drawn from volume V of given metal and its resitivity is ρ.
 
Let l be the length of wire and a be the cross-section area
 
then we have R = ρ×(l/a) , since V = l×a we write Resistance as R = ρ×( l2 / V ) ....................(4)
 
square Loop is made of wire of length l, hence side of loop is l/4 and its area l2/16
 
using all these informations, we can write eqn.(3) as , begin mathsize 12px style q space equals space fraction numerator open parentheses begin display style bevelled l squared over 16 end style close parentheses cross times B over denominator rho cross times open parentheses begin display style bevelled l squared over V end style close parentheses end fraction space equals space fraction numerator V cross times B over denominator 16 cross times rho end fraction end style .................(5)
